
In this episode of the Maxwell Leadership Podcast, John C. Maxwell shares timeless principles for turning your personal development into a lifelong journey of growth. You'll learn how to use your past as a teacher—not a trap—and apply positive thinking techniques and goal-setting habits to create a brighter tomorrow.
After John's lesson, Mark Cole and Chris Robinson unpack how to apply these lessons to your leadership, helping you strengthen your success mindset, overcome setbacks, and keep moving toward your dreams.
You'll learn how to:
-
Turn lessons from failure into lasting success
-
Build momentum through daily self-improvement habits
-
Use reflection to set meaningful goals
-
Cultivate a growth-oriented, positive mindset
-
Keep your leadership development journey alive
